As an expert in international express logistics, here’s how to efficiently transport infant and toddler clothing from China to Europe—tailored for bulk shipments while ensuring compliance, cost-effectiveness, and speed:
?? Core Transportation Options
Based on industry standards (sea/rail/air), select based on your priorities:
| Mode | Best For | Key Advantages | Typical Transit Time* | Cost Level |
|||-|||
| Sea Freight | Large volumes u003e500kg (full container loads) | Lowest cost per unit; ideal for non-urgent bulk orders like seasonal stock | 4–6 weeks | ?????? |
| Rail (Eurasia Land Bridge) | Medium batches (LCL consolidations) | Faster than sea, lower carbon footprint; stable schedule avoiding port congestion | ~2–3 weeks | ???????? |
| Air Cargo | Urgent small shipments (u003c100kg or time-sensitive)| Fastest delivery; suitable for samples/replenishment stock during peak seasons | 3–7 days | ?????????? |
*Transit times vary by origin/destination ports (e.g., Shanghai→Hamburg vs. Ningbo→Rotterdam). Major Chinese hubs include Shanghai, Ningbo, and Shenzhen . For Europe, key entry points are Rotterdam (NL), Hamburg (DE), or Antwerp (BE).

?? Critical Preparation Steps
? Packaging u0026 Compliance
- Use durable cartons with waterproof liners to protect against humidity during long transit. Vacuum-seal bags reduce volume without compromising garment quality.
- Mandatory labeling includes:
- HS Code 6109.10 (knitted/crocheted baby apparel under EU tariff regulations)
- Material composition tags (cotton/polyester blend declaration required for safety certification)
- Washing instructions in target market languages (German/French/Spanish etc.)
- Avoid restricted substances like azore dyes banned under REACH regulations—opt for Oeko-Tex certified fabrics.
?? Customs Clearance Protocols
Submit these documents early:
1. Commercial Invoice listing precise quantities/values per SKU
2. Packing List cross-referenced with bill of lading numbers
3. Certificate of Origin (Form A for preferential duty rates via China-EU FTA agreements)
4. Test reports proving compliance with EN71 safety standards for children’s textiles

?? Optimization Strategies
Multimodal Combo Approach
For cost-sensitive medium orders: combine rail mainleg + last-mile road haulage. Example route: Chengdu → Duisburg by block train, then truck distribution across Western Europe cuts logistics costs by 18–22% vs pure air freight.
Consolidated LCL Service
Leverage groupage services where multiple shippers share container space. Top providers like ZIM/MSC offer weekly sailings from China with real-time tracking visibility through their TMS systems. Perfect if your cargo weighs u003c2 tons.
Peak Season Survival Guide
During Q4 holiday rush:
? Book space by August latest to avoid equipment shortages
? Diversify across 3+ carriers simultaneously using freight forwarders like DB Schenker who manage multi-carrier allocations automatically
? Pre-position safety stock in bonded warehouses near EU borders (e.g., Malaszewicze PDI hub)
